trace: remove malloc tracing
The malloc vtable is not supported anymore in glib, because it broke when constructors called g_malloc. Remove tracing of g_malloc, g_realloc and g_free calls. Note that, for systemtap users, glib also provides tracepoints glib.mem_alloc, glib.mem_free, glib.mem_realloc, glib.slice_alloc and glib.slice_free.
